Job Duties
- Carries out telephone answering and reception duties as required
- takes complete messages with pertinent information and communicates messages to the intended recipient
- greets residents and visitors
- answers inquiries and gives directions
- collates brochures for the marketing department
- prepares meal tickets for team members and family members
- tallies meal count sheets for the Dining staff
- updates the Resident Phone List and Roster and Move-In and Move-Out Register daily
- manages appointments for residents and family members such as hairdresser or transportation
- maintains and keeps desk and entry area neat and organized
- organizes and distributes mail to residents, Executive Director and Department Coordinators
- maintains resident forms for miscellaneous credits
- maintains adherence to all company personnel policies and established operating policies and procedures
- other duties as assigned
